Angry Window Tinting on Side Rear Windows

I recently was cited by VA State police for illegally tinted side windows in my four year old Chrysler PT cruiser. I have not modified this car in any way since purchase. When I asked the officer who cited me if this means that all PT Cruisers are illegal in the state of Virginia he replied "yes, until they change the law". I went to a glass shop to get my windows replaced and they said the only replacement would be the same "courtesy tint". Chrysler says this car meets all state laws. The court wants me to come into compliance by February 10, 2005. I have no way of coming into compliance. All new vehicles on lots seem to have even more tint than I have. Second citation would be $500 fine and two points. Chrysler customer relations does not answer after several 1 hour call waiting. Virginia law says 35% and Chrysler has already said they are 20-25% standard!! What's going on here??

Re: Window Tinting on Side Rear Windows

Go see a lawyer. The 35% tinting law applies to cars. The PT Cruiser is technically a light truck and conforms to the laws for light trucks and multipurpose vehicles. MPV and light trucks can have any level of tint on back side and back windows according to the VA law.
